码迷,mamicode.com
首页 > 编程语言
C++基础之map按key排序
在项目当中有要用到map按key排序的需求,就在百度上搜了一下:typedef pair PAIR;int cmp(const PAIR& x, const PAIR& y){return x.second imgdis; //待排序对象,根据double值排序imgdis[1] = 3;imgd....
分类:编程语言   时间:2015-01-08 22:36:40    阅读次数:558
Java中abstract与interface
抽象类(abstract class)的特点:1.抽象类、抽象方法都必须使用abstract修饰。2.抽象类中,可以有非抽象方法,甚至可以是没有任何方法或变量的空类。 对于抽象类中不定义抽象方法的用意在于:使该类不能被创建对象。3.抽象方法,是不能有方法体的。 对于抽象方法的访问限制符,可以是pu....
分类:编程语言   时间:2015-01-08 22:34:25    阅读次数:263
javascript and dom1
分类:编程语言   时间:2015-01-08 22:34:50    阅读次数:268
Java时间简单操作
使用java操作时间感觉真真蛋疼,还是我大C#舒服,一个DateTime全部搞定这里的Date指的是java.util.Date获取当前时间: // 创建一个当前时间的Date对象 Date time = new Date();蛋疼的地方,对时间增、减操作: ...
分类:编程语言   时间:2015-01-08 22:32:14    阅读次数:282
C++ 基础学习
C++基础知识的资源分享...
分类:编程语言   时间:2015-01-08 21:42:34    阅读次数:201
Java中的内部类
内部类Inner Class   将相关的类组织在一起,从而降低了命名空间的混乱。   一个内部类可以定义在另一个类里,可以定义在函数里,甚至可以作为一个表达式的一部分。   Java中的内部类共分为四种:   静态内部类static inner class (also called nested class)   成员内部类member inner class ...
分类:编程语言   时间:2015-01-08 21:43:02    阅读次数:291
Unity3d 使用DX11的曲面细分
计算机不能直接生成曲线,更不能直接生成曲面。计算机屏幕上看到的曲线、曲面实际上是由无数个多边形构成的。多边形越多,曲面就会更为真实,曲面细分(Tessellation)就是这样的一个技术。 曲面细分,有时甚至能化低模为高模,省去不少功夫,产生效果也真是漂亮, 我们看看unity是怎么实现它的。。。...
分类:编程语言   时间:2015-01-08 21:42:41    阅读次数:344
编写C语言跨平台函数(以清屏和休眠函数为例)
支持C语言的平台有许多,常见的编译器如VC、gcc、Clang等。不同的编译器共同点是都支持标准C(ANSI C),但是各自却又有自己独立的、平台相关的功能以及函数接口。这通常为程序的移植性带来很多问题。比如清屏函数,Windows里面我们调用System("cls");而Linux下这段代码不能使用。还有休眠,Linux下有sleep函数,它的粒度是秒,usleep函数它的粒度是微妙。Windows下休眠函数Sleep,它的粒度是毫秒。...
分类:编程语言   时间:2015-01-08 21:40:58    阅读次数:505
【算法导论】二叉树的前中后序非递归遍历实现
二叉树的非递归遍历...
分类:编程语言   时间:2015-01-08 21:39:08    阅读次数:208
javascript Date format(js日期格式化)
方法一: // 对Date的扩展,将 Date 转化为指定格式的String // 月(M)、日(d)、小时(h)、分(m)、秒(s)、季度(q) 可以用 1-2 个占位符, // 年(y)可以用 1-4 个占位符,毫秒(S)只能用 1 个占位符(是 1-3 位的数字) // 例子: // (new Date()).Format("yyyy-MM-dd hh:mm:ss.S") =...
分类:编程语言   时间:2015-01-08 21:40:01    阅读次数:1480
Unity3d 使用DX11的曲面细分
计算机不能直接生成曲线,更不能直接生成曲面。计算机屏幕上看到的曲线、曲面实际上是由无数个多边形构成的。多边形越多,曲面就会更为真实,曲面细分(Tessellation)就是这样的一个技术。 曲面细分,有时甚至能化低模为高模,省去不少功夫,产生效果也真是漂亮, 我们看看unity是怎么实现它的。。。
分类:编程语言   时间:2015-01-08 21:36:54    阅读次数:329
探秘推荐引擎之协同过滤算法小综述
数学大神、统计学大神和数据挖掘推荐大神请关注。一、数学期望的理解 早些时候,法国有两个大数学家,一个叫做布莱士·帕斯卡,一个叫做费马。帕斯卡认识两个赌徒,这两个赌徒向他提出了一个问题。他们说,他俩下赌金之后,约定谁先赢满5局,谁就获得全部赌金。赌了半天,A赢了4局,B赢了3局,时间很晚了,他们都不....
分类:编程语言   时间:2015-01-08 21:34:42    阅读次数:288
HDU 1556 Color the ball【算法的优化】
/*解题思路:每次仅仅求解一開始的第一个数字,让第一个数字加一,最后的一个数字的后面一个数减一。我们能够想想,最后加的时候,就是加上前面一个数出现的次数和自己本身出现的次数。解题人:lingnichong解题时间:2014-10-25 10:30:46解题体会:因为測试区间非常大,所以此题非常eas...
分类:编程语言   时间:2015-01-08 21:29:34    阅读次数:206
通过IEnumerable和IDisposable实现可暂停和取消的任务队列
一般来说,软件中总会有一些长时间的操作,这类操作包括下载文件,转储数据库,或者处理复杂的运算。 一种处理做法是,在主界面上提示正在操作中,有进度条,其他部分不可用。这里带来很大的问题, 使用者不知道到底执行到什么程度,无法暂停或者取消任务。而即使花了很大的力气实现了暂停和取消,也很难形成通用的模.....
分类:编程语言   时间:2015-01-08 21:25:26    阅读次数:281
storm/java web项目引用的jar该放容器的lib下吗?
不要把第三方jar包放到容器的lib中,把容器不提供的第三方jar打包到项目中,容器提供的jar就不打包到jar包中。项目运行时,会先检测项目本身打入的jar包,然后再去容器的lib下面寻找jar包。 为什么不建议把第三方...
分类:编程语言   时间:2015-01-08 20:17:56    阅读次数:354
Spring环境搭建错误
1,cvc-complex-type.2.4.c 此错误是因为导使用jar包都是spring 4.0的jar包,但是配置文件引入的xsd文件版本不对,或者少引入了xsd文件导致。 2,Exception in thread "main" org.springframework.beans.factory.BeanCreationExcep...
分类:编程语言   时间:2015-01-08 20:15:27    阅读次数:258
Java 判断IP地址为内网IP还是公网IP
Java 判断IP地址为内网IP还是公网IP...
分类:编程语言   时间:2015-01-08 20:17:02    阅读次数:246
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!